Output 63c3f64f913ef62a392f18f5da04a6e383b8c453d8b6876c216f5a9bd35ea75a:0

value
1346023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98dd4200730c33ea01cb3f8bb4764680c4030d0c OP_EQUAL
address
3FdHgxumQrXDudzeXpNQ2bvuGauUdJ8ZyC
transaction
63c3f64f913ef62a392f18f5da04a6e383b8c453d8b6876c216f5a9bd35ea75a